USN-1056-1: OpenOffice.org vulnerabilities
2 February 2011
openoffice.org vulnerabilities
A security issue affects these releases of Ubuntu and its derivatives:
- Ubuntu 10.10
- Ubuntu 10.04 LTS
- Ubuntu 9.10
- Ubuntu 8.04 LTS
Summary
Multiple vulnerabilities in OpenOffice.org
Software Description
- openoffice.org - office productivity suite
Details
Charlie Miller discovered several heap overflows in PPT processing. If a user or automated system were tricked into opening a specially crafted PPT document, a remote attacker could execute arbitrary code with user privileges. Ubuntu 10.10 was not affected. (CVE-2010-2935, CVE-2010-2936)
Marc Schoenefeld discovered that directory traversal was not correctly handled in XSLT, OXT, JAR, or ZIP files. If a user or automated system were tricked into opening a specially crafted document, a remote attacker overwrite arbitrary files, possibly leading to arbitrary code execution with user privileges. (CVE-2010-3450)
Dan Rosenberg discovered multiple heap overflows in RTF and DOC processing. If a user or automated system were tricked into opening a specially crafted RTF or DOC document, a remote attacker could execute arbitrary code with user privileges. (CVE-2010-3451, CVE-2010-3452, CVE-2010-3453, CVE-2010-3454)
Dmitri Gribenko discovered that OpenOffice.org did not correctly handle LD_LIBRARY_PATH in various tools. If a local attacker tricked a user or automated system into using OpenOffice.org from an attacker-controlled directory, they could execute arbitrary code with user privileges. (CVE-2010-3689)
Marc Schoenefeld discovered that OpenOffice.org did not correctly process PNG images. If a user or automated system were tricked into opening a specially crafted document, a remote attacker could execute arbitrary code with user privileges. (CVE-2010-4253)
It was discovered that OpenOffice.org did not correctly process TGA images. If a user or automated system were tricked into opening a specially crafted document, a remote attacker could execute arbitrary code with user privileges. (CVE-2010-4643)
Update instructions
The problem can be corrected by updating your system to the following package versions:
- Ubuntu 10.10
- openoffice.org-core - 1:3.2.1-7ubuntu1.1
- openoffice.org-impress - 1:3.2.1-7ubuntu1.1
- openoffice.org-writer - 1:3.2.1-7ubuntu1.1
- Ubuntu 10.04 LTS
- openoffice.org-core - 1:3.2.0-7ubuntu4.2
- openoffice.org-impress - 1:3.2.0-7ubuntu4.2
- openoffice.org-writer - 1:3.2.0-7ubuntu4.2
- Ubuntu 9.10
- openoffice.org-core - 1:3.1.1-5ubuntu1.3
- openoffice.org-impress - 1:3.1.1-5ubuntu1.3
- openoffice.org-writer - 1:3.1.1-5ubuntu1.3
- Ubuntu 8.04 LTS
- openoffice.org-core - 1:2.4.1-1ubuntu2.5
- openoffice.org-impress - 1:2.4.1-1ubuntu2.5
- openoffice.org-writer - 1:2.4.1-1ubuntu2.5
To update your system, please follow these instructions: https://wiki.ubuntu.com/Security/Upgrades.
In general, a standard system update will make all the necessary changes.
